Metal Oxide Catalysts Drive Efficiency in Petrochemical and Environmental Processes

Metal oxide catalysts are foundational to optimizing petrochemical processes and improving environmental quality through applications in oxidation, depollution, and biomass conversion.

Catalysts · 2017

01

Key Findings

  • 01Metal oxide catalysts are indispensable in refining and petrochemical industries.
  • 02These catalysts are critical for environmental remediation and green chemistry initiatives.
  • 03Applications span selective and total oxidation, depollution, biomass conversion, and photocatalysis.
  • 04Future developments are heavily influenced by environmental regulations and sustainability goals.

Method & Evidence

AimWhat are the primary industrial applications and future directions for metal oxide catalysts in petrochemical and environmental sectors?
MethodLiterature Review
ProcedureThe review synthesizes existing research on metal oxide catalysts, covering their fundamental principles, various types, synthesis methods, and performance in diverse applications such as acid-base reactions, oxidation, depollution, biomass conversion, and photocatalysis.
